A superb example of a Georgian miniature portrait attributed to the prolific and highly regarded George Engleheart (1750-1829).

Portraits such as this were painted before the age of photography, as a keepsake. They were extremely popular with Naval families, as the men spent long periods away from home. Examples of George Engleheart's work are on display today at the Victoria & Albert Museum.

This portrait features an unknown gentleman, painted in watercolour on ivory. The portrait is set in a copper coloured base metal and a later, Victorian 9k gold chain.

Size of pendant 41mm x 36mm (1.6 x 0.7 inches).

The chain measures 19 inches in length.
